Elme Communities (ELME) — Long-term Investment Intensity

Latest as of June 2023: 97.5%

Elme Communities (ELME)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 97.5% as of June 2023. Long-term investments of $1.79 Billion represent 97.5% of total assets of $1.84 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Check ELME asset liquidity ratio to evaluate the company's liquid asset resilience ratio.
